On the front of this shop it states that it is a tobacconist, which I guess just means that it sells cigarettes and all its associated bits and bobs (lighters, cigars, rolling papers - you get the idea).
However, if you looked at the shop front, you could be forgiven for thinking it was more of a souvenir shop if anything. The windows that can be seen from the outside are packed with various little models and ornaments, including an owl and a deer, somewhat bizarrely.
Inside, they also sell various sweets and ice creams that are all perfectly pleasant without setting your pulse racing too much. Basically, it's a bit like a newsagent but replace the large assortment of magazines with a large assortment of souvenirs and models that you don't really want or need but somehow end up buying anyway. read more
